Theoretical investigations on the elastic properties of CaSiO3 by EOS
The elastic properties of CaSiO3 are calculated as a function of temperature using different equations of state (EOS). Equations of state have been used to study pressure as a function of volume compression at a given temperature. The EOS’s for solids under low compression by evaluating the pressure-volume derivative properties viz., isothermal bulk modulus and its pressure derivatives calculated for CaSiO3. The elastic moduli such as Bulk modulus, Shear modulus, Young’s modulus and Poisson’s ratio have been calculated as a function of pressure.
